One of Randstad's key clients are looking for TWO experienced Residential Support Workers to support a young person in a Dundee based service. The service is looking for workers with flexible availability to support the young person on a 2-1 basis.

Flexible full time availability, including weekend availability is important for this role. They are preferably looking for workers to join a two on two off day shift rota.

To succeed in this role, experience in working with young autistic people with behavioural difficulties is essential. Working closely with other support services you will need to ensure a secure, safe and supportive environment for all service users.

A successful child residential support worker will be responsible for:

- Working effectively as part of a team of child support workers

- Hitting the ground running!

- Providing 24 hours care to a vulnerable young people

- Supporting service users with early trauma and emotional behavioural difficulties

- Taking service users out into the community and to school each day

- Ensuring professional boundaries are in place

- Maintaining professional manner and working to National Care Standards

- Working to a flexible schedule, including night shifts, weekends and bank holidays and Christmas period

To be successful in your application, you will:

- Have a minimum 12 months of experience in UK based Residential Childcare

- Have flexibility in the roles undertaken

- Have strong communication skills

- Register under the PVG scheme

- Full driving license

- Preferably obtained SVQ level 3 in Health and Social Care, or equivalent
